Adani Power acquires full stake of infra development firm SPPL, EREPL for Rs 609 Cr
New Delhi: Adani Power, a subsidiary of Indian conglomerate Adani Group completes the 100% acquisition of infra development firms, Support Properties Private Limited (SPPL) and Eternus Real Estate Private Limited (EREPL). The private thermal power producer on Monday buys all equity shares from their respective shareholders.
The acquisition for both firms stands at Rs. 609.4 crore cumulatively. However earlier this month the company signed a share purchase agreement to acquire 100 percent equity shares of these two companies.
BSE filing stated, "All the related steps/activities for acquisition of 100 percent equity shares of SPPL and EREPL have now been completed.
The acquiring cost for Support Properties is Rs. 280.10 crore, while for Eternus Real Estate the consideration is Rs 329.30 crore.
